Steps to Refurbish French Doors

1. Examine the Condition
Action: Examine the doors closely. Try to find indications of damage, such as rot, warping, or fractures.
| Condition | Option |
|---|---|
| Minor Scratches | Sand down and repaint or stain. |
| Moderate Damage | Usage wood filler to repair and then sand down. |
| Serious Rot | Change impacted panels or seek advice from a professional. |
2. Remove Hardware
Action: Remove any handles, locks, or hinges.
3. Clean the Doors
Action: Use a moderate cleaning agent and water solution to clean up the doors.
4. Sand the Surface
Action: Sand the doors to get rid of old paint, stain, or varnish. Start with coarse grit and shift to great grit.
5. Repair Damages
- Fill: Use wood filler for fractures and holes.
- Replace: If there's severe rot, change the broken parts.
6. Refinish the Doors
Choose either to paint or stain. Follow these steps:
- Primer: Apply a suitable guide if painting.
- Paint/Stain: Apply a very first coat and allow to dry. Sand lightly and apply a 2nd coat.
7. Reinstall Hardware
When the paint or stain has actually cured, reinstall all hardware, guaranteeing whatever functions properly.
8. Set Up Weather Stripping
For added energy performance, install brand-new weather condition stripping along the edges of the doors.
9. Last Inspection
Do a last check to make sure all parts are running smoothly and look visually enticing.
Common Issues to Address During Refurbishment
Throughout the refurbishment procedure, numerous common issues may emerge that require attending to.
- Drafts: Replace seals and weather condition stripping to get rid of air leaks.
- Sticking: Sand down locations where doors stick; this could show misalignment.
- Locks: Ensure all locks are working and consider changing any faulty locks.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How frequently should French doors be refurbished?
French doors ought to be checked every few years for signs of wear. Regular maintenance can lengthen the time between repairs.
2. Can I refurbish my French doors if they are made from fiberglass?
Yes, fiberglass doors can be reconditioned. Focus on the specific care guidelines for fiberglass materials.
3. What tools will I need for refurbishment?
Standard tools consist of:
- Screwdrivers
- Sandpaper or a power sander
- Wood filler
- Paintbrushes or rollers
- Primer and paint or wood stain
- Weather condition stripping
4. Is it much better to repaint or stain my French doors?
This frequently depends upon individual choice. Staining reveals the wood grain however needs more maintenance. Painting provides a more comprehensive color option but might hide the wood's natural beauty.
5. Should I employ a professional or do it myself?
This depends on your confidence and skill level. DIY can be fulfilling and cost-effective, but hiring a professional makes sure a high requirement of craftsmanship.
